大家好,今天我来和大家聊一聊关于如何使用Debian系统搭建个人NAS服务器:全面指南的问题。在接下来的内容中,我会将我所了解的信息进行归纳整理,并与大家分享,让我们一起来看看吧。
搭建个人NAS服务器:全面指南
随着数字时代的到来,越来越多的用户需要存储和管理大量的数据。个人NAS(网络附加存储)服务器提供了一个方便的解决方案,它允许用户通过网络访问和共享文件。Debian系统,以其稳定性和灵活性,成为搭建NAS服务器的理想选择。本文将介绍如何使用Debian系统搭建个人NAS服务器。
首先,选择合适的硬件是搭建NAS服务器的第一步。确保你的硬件支持网络连接,并有足够的存储空间来满足你的需求。接下来,安装Debian操作系统。在安装过程中,选择最小化安装以减少不必要的软件包,确保系统稳定运行。
安装完成后,配置网络是关键。编辑`/etc/network/interfaces`文件,设置静态IP地址,确保NAS服务器在局域网内始终可访问。例如:
“`bash
auto eth0
iface eth0 inet static
address ***.***.*.***
netmask ***.***.***.*
gateway ***.***.*.*
“`
安装Samba服务是实现文件共享的关键步骤。Samba允许在Windows、Linux和Mac系统之间共享文件。通过运行以下命令安装Samba:
“`bash
sudo apt-get install samba
“`
配置Samba共享目录,编辑`/etc/samba/smb.conf`文件,添加一个新的共享段落:
“`ini
[Share]
path = /mnt/share
browseable = yes
read only = no
valid users = user
“`
确保共享目录存在,并设置适当的权限:
“`bash
sudo mkdir -p /mnt/share
sudo chown user:user /mnt/share
sudo chmod 0770 /mnt/share
“`
重启Samba服务使配置生效:
“`bash
sudo systemctl restart smbd
“`
此外,为了远程访问NAS服务器,可以安装和配置SSH服务。通过SSH,你可以远程登录到服务器进行管理:
“`bash
sudo apt-get install openssh-server
“`
确保SSH服务在启动时运行:
“`bash
sudo systemctl enable ssh
“`
通过以上步骤,你将拥有一个基本的个人NAS服务器。你可以根据需要安装其他服务,如FTP、WebDAV等,以增强NAS服务器的功能。记得定期更新系统和软件包,以确保服务器的安全性和稳定性。
搭建个人NAS服务器是一个涉及多个步骤的过程,但通过细心规划和配置,你可以创建一个强大且可靠的存储解决方案,满足你的个人或家庭需求。
以上是跟如何使用Debian系统搭建个人NAS服务器:全面指南的相关内容仅供参考,如有不当之处,请联系我删除。本站不对文章内容的准确性和完整性负责,读者在使用时请自行判断和承担风险。
暂无评论内容